阅读:1689回复:19
为什么郁闷的人总是我?我的板子上的D12的晶振输出怎么是48M????(我实际设置为12M)
为什么郁闷的人总是我?我的板子上的D12的晶振输出怎么是48M????(我实际设置为12M)
|
|
沙发#
发布于:2003-07-08 08:00
MCU上电后要延迟一段时间再对D12操作,否则会使D12状态不定。
|
|
|
板凳#
发布于:2003-07-08 08:45
建议外接的MCU不要用D12的CLKOUT,其输出信号不是很稳定,另接一个晶振比较好。
|
|
地板#
发布于:2003-07-08 10:52
我现在就是外接的晶振,而没有直接接clkout
|
|
地下室#
发布于:2003-07-08 16:32
那你的D12应该是外接6M晶振er而不应该是12M啊!
|
|
5楼#
发布于:2003-07-08 17:25
D12的外接晶振是6M,但CLKOUT引脚的输出却是48M啊,这让我纳闷
|
|
6楼#
发布于:2003-07-09 08:29
我想这可能没问题,因为D12的CLKOUT是可编程的,在固件里的F3命令就可以更改CLKOUT的分频系数,我想你设置一下应该就可以了。呵呵。
|
|
7楼#
发布于:2003-07-09 15:17
但我现在的分频系数设置的是0X03,晶振输出应为12M才对啊
|
|
8楼#
发布于:2003-07-09 15:20
你一定要用CLKOUT引脚吗?
|
|
9楼#
发布于:2003-07-09 15:26
我没有用到CLKOUT引脚,但我在调试时,测量D12的CLKOUT引脚时发现输出为48M,我觉得有问题,而且执行reconnect()后,主机根本没有发现未知设备,不知这是为什么?
|
|
10楼#
发布于:2003-07-09 15:39
问题是你在执行RECONNECT之前,主机认识D12吗,枚举过程能通过吗?
|
|
11楼#
发布于:2003-07-09 16:22
那在执行RECONNECT之前,主机如何认识D12啊?
|
|
12楼#
发布于:2003-07-09 16:33
就是说你的D12现在的枚举过程还没有成功是吗?
|
|
13楼#
发布于:2003-07-09 17:19
是的
|
|
14楼#
发布于:2003-07-10 08:38
你不会是把HCT123给去掉了吧?
|
|
15楼#
发布于:2003-07-10 09:35
是的
|
|
16楼#
发布于:2003-07-10 09:42
我建议你把HCT123加上再试试,估计是你现在的时序有问题,顺便问一声,为什么要去掉HCT123呢?
|
|
17楼#
发布于:2003-07-10 10:49
我现在的晶振输出是正确的,主机也可以发现位置设备,但枚举还不成功,不知为什么?
|
|
18楼#
发布于:2003-07-10 11:07
你的HCT123是按照D12的板子连接的吗?
|
|
19楼#
发布于:2003-07-10 11:20
我还没有接74HC123
|
|